How they compare
Micronesia, Federated States of currently reports 7.49 against 6.8 in Vanuatu, a difference of 0.69.
That makes Micronesia, Federated States of's figure about 1.1 times Vanuatu's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Vanuatu ahead.
Micronesia, Federated States of ranks 2nd and Vanuatu ranks 5th of 191 countries.
Micronesia, Federated States of has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Micronesia, Federated States of | Vanuatu |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 5.35 | 5.29 | 0.0601 | Micronesia, Federated States of |
| 1990s | 5.69 | 4.71 | 0.9774 | Micronesia, Federated States of |
| 2000s | 6.48 | 5.34 | 1.14 | Micronesia, Federated States of |
| 2010s | 7.28 | 6.47 | 0.8077 | Micronesia, Federated States of |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
